I would cover your shoulders in as close to white fabric as you can get to get it the most accurate.

But personally from this photo I don’t see warmth and I don’t see high contrast. True winters are kind of rare ime because they are cool toned and high contrast. While your skin is pale and your hair is kind of dark, I’m not getting a ton of contrast from you (I’m also a pale skinned dark haired soft autumn so this is pretty common)

Your eyes are fairly light and the pink tones in your skin definitely cool toned—warm tones would be a distinct yellowish tint in the skin and hair. I’m leaning soft summer. Try some soft summer colors on through draping or trying on clothes and see how you feel. Your skin and eyes should light up
